Obituary, 47 Apr 1919, "Amherst Weekly News", (Amherst, Lorain Co., OH)
HENRY BRAUN DIED IN HENRIETTA
Henry Braun, wealthy and well known farmer of Henrietta died at his home Monday afternoon following a lingering illness. Mr. Braun has been ill for the past ten years. The deceased was 75 years of age and has been a member of the St. Peter's Evangelical church for the past 20 years.
He is survived by his widow and three daughters and two sons. Mr. I. W. Kothes, Mr. Andre Schubeert and Mrs. Henry Mentz of Elyria, Edward and William of Henrietta.
The funeral services were held from the late home in Henrietta at one o'clock and from the St. Peter's Church at two-thirty. Rev. Egli was in charge of the services and burial was made in Cleveland Ave. cemetery.

Amherst News Times- September 17, 1919;
HENRY BRAUN OF HENRIETTA PASSES AWAY
"Henry Braun of Henrietta, age 75, passed away Monday afternoon at his home. He had been ailing for the last 10 years.

Mr. Braun was well known throughout the county. He was a member of St. Peter's Evangelical church in Amherst.

Surviving are his widow three daughters, Mrs Henry Ments, Mrs. L. W. Kothe, of Henrietta; Mrs. Andrew Schubert of Elyria, and two sons William & Edward of Henrietta.
Funeral ervices were held Wednesday afternoon at 1 o'clock from the home and at 2:30 from the Evangelical church. Rev E. Egli conducting. Interment was at Cleveland avenue cemetery."
